Is carbon dioxide ever a liquid? Liquid state: carbon dioxide can exist as a liquid below the critical temperature of 31°C and above the triple point with a temperature of -56.6 °C and 4.18 bar gauge, see also P-T-Diagram.
Is carbon dioxide a solid or liquid? Carbon dioxide; is an odourless, colourless gas, which is acidic and non-flammable. It also has a solid and a liquid form. Carbon dioxide is a molecule with the molecular formula CO2. Carbon dioxide, CO2, is a colorless gas.
Why is CO2 never a liquid? r CO2 to exist as a liquid the ambient pressure must be greater than 5.2 atm. CO2 in the liquid state cannot exist on Earth’s surface at standard pressure. This is why solid CO2 is called “dry ice.” It undergoes sublimation to get to the vapor state. Methane is not soluble in water, but carbon dioxide is.
Is carbon ever a liquid? Mark – Well, there is a liquid form of carbon, but it’s extremely unusual. … If you want it to be a liquid, you have to put it under incredible pressure while you’re actually heating it up that much. So, it’s only under very, very extreme circumstances that you can force carbon to be a liquid.

What is carbon cycle science definition?
The carbon cycle describes the process in which carbon atoms continually travel from the atmosphere to the Earth and then back into the atmosphere. … On Earth, most carbon is stored in rocks and sediments, while the rest is located in the ocean, atmosphere, and in living organisms.

Which is more electronegative carbon or silicon meritnation?
Out of carbon and silicon, carbon is more electronegative compared to silicon because the size of silicon atom is more compared to carbon. So the effective attraction of nucleus on the bonded pair of electron decreases and hence electronegativity decreases.
How biochar capture carbon?
Carbon sequestration through biochar involves pyrolysis or gasification of organic material in low-oxygen conditions from plant waste3. The resulting char can be mixed with existing soil, acting as a fertilizer4 and sequestering carbon with a mean residence time of about 2,000 years5.

Why is calcium carbonate used to extract caffeine?
The caffeine will dissolve in the hot water, but so will some other compounds, known as tannins (a type of carboxylic acid). The calcium carbonate should convert these tannins into insoluble salts, which will then drop out of solution. … The caffeine is located in the filtrate (the liquid that passed through the filter).
How much carbon is considered carbonated?
Carbonation is measured as either ‘volumes’ or grams per litre. One volume means 1 L of CO2 in 1 L of drink. This is equivalent to 1.96 g/L (normally quoted as 2 g/L). A typical carbonated soft drink contains approximately 3–4 volumes (6–8 g/L) CO2.

Where is carbon dioxide transported from in the body?
Carbon dioxide is transported in the blood from the tissue to the lungs in three ways:1 (i) dissolved in solution; (ii) buffered with water as carbonic acid; (iii) bound to proteins, particularly haemoglobin. Approximately 75% of carbon dioxide is transport in the red blood cell and 25% in the plasma.
Do younger forest create more carbon secretion than old?
Forests of different ages play different roles in removing carbon from the atmosphere and storing it in wood. Old forests have accumulated more carbon than younger forests; however, young forests grow rapidly, removing much more CO2 each year from the atmosphere than an older forest covering the same area.
What objects can be carbon dated?
The most suitable types of sample for radiocarbon dating are charcoal and well-preserved wood, although leather, cloth, paper, peat, shell and bone can also be used.
